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ols rushed for 13 yards on four carries against the Miami Dolphins in Week 11. He also caught two passes for 16 yards during the game.
Posted: 11/10/2025 2:57 am GMT
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ols rushed five times for 25 yards and caught one pass for four yards in a 44-22 loss to the Detroit Lions in Week 10.
Huddle Up: The five carries were a season high for McNichols, and he was the only Washington running back to catch a pass. McNichols' main role has been as the third-down back for Washington, but he will likely need an injury to either Chris Rodriguez Jr. or Jacory Croskey-Merritt to be worth considering as a fantasy starter. In the meantime, McNichols can be stashed as a RB5 in PPR formats.

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ols carried the ball once for no gain in Week 9 against the Seattle Seahawks. He was not targeted in the passing game.
Posted: 10/28/2025 3:47 am GMT
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ols ran once for four yards and caught five passes (on six targets) for a team-best 64 yards against the Kansas City Chiefs in Week 8.
Huddle Up: In the last three games, McNichols has totaled 35 yards, 45 yards, and 68 yards while logging 5, 4, and 6 touches, respectively. That's called maximizing your opportunities. We'll see if it leads to an increased role in the weeks ahead, but those in deeper leagues should consider moving to add McNichols. Those in standard leagues can stick him on the watch list.
Posted: 10/20/2025 6:45 am GMT
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ols carried the ball twice for 22 yards against the Dallas Cowboys in Week 7. He also had two receptions for 23 yards.
Posted: 10/14/2025 6:13 am GMT
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ols ran twice for five yards in Week 6 against the Chicago Bears. He also chipped in with three catches (on four targets) for 30 yards.
Posted: 10/06/2025 1:52 am GMT
Washington Commanders RB Jeremy McNichols rushed once for six yards in Week 5 against the Los Angeles Chargers, while adding a 12-yard reception on two targets.
Huddle Up: McNichols is third on the tailback pecking order behind rookie Jacory Croskey-Merritt and Chris Rodriguez Jr. Both McNichols and Rodriguez are well behind Croskey-Merritt on the depth chart at this point, and McNichols is only worth retaining in deeper fantasy leagues.
